Brief summary

The goal of this clinical trial is to test if children aged between 6 and 14 years who are receiving a dental injection will feel less pain by using a vibration device applied to the injection site during the injection compared to vibrating the lip using only the researcher's hands without using the vibration device. It will also test if this device makes them feel less anxious during the injection. The main question it aims to answer is: Does using the Vibrasthetic device make dental injections more comfortable for children? Researchers will compare the effect of using this vibration device versus using their hands for manual vibration of the lip in the same child. Participants will: * Experience one method of vibration during their visit to the dentist (either the vibration device or manual vibration). * then after 2 weeks they will go to the same dentist again and experience the other method of vibration. * Receive the dental treatment they need in both visits. Participants will be asked to rate the pain they felt after the injection. This will be done by the participants choosing one of 6 pictures we will show them. Each picture explains the level of the pain they felt, and each picture has a score. We will score the pain the participants felt by looking at which picture they chose to describe their pain from the injection.

Detailed description

Each participant will start their dental appointment by them sitting on a chair beside the dental chair and having their heart rate recorded by a pulse oximeter for baseline comfort level. They will be randomly assigned to either receive the vibration using the Vibrasthetic vibration device or by the dentist researcher manually vibrating the participant's lip during the injection. Topical anesthesia will be applied on the injection site and then they will receive the dental injection along with experiencing vibration in the area of the dental injection administered. Immediately after the injection, the participant will rate the pain intensity felt during the injection using validated Pain Scale (Wong-Baker). During the injection, a separate researcher, called the monitor, will monitor the participant's pain using the FLACC scale (Face, Legs, Activity, Cry, Consolability). Also, the monitor will record the participant's behavior using the Frankl scale, after which the participant will receiver their needed dental treatment. In the following visit, the participant will receive the other vibration method before their dental treatment with the recording of the same metrics by the researchers.

PROCEDUREManual vibration

The operator will hold the participant's lip between their forefinger and thumb to manually vibrate the lip and hence vibrating the injection site.

Inclusion criteria

* Children aged 6-14 years * who have previously received local anesthesia * and whose behavior, according to the Frankl scale, was positive or definitely positive * and the absence of systemic diseases or known allergies to local anesthetic agents

Exclusion criteria

* Uncooperative children * Children with special healthcare needs * Children with conditions affecting pain perception

Design outcomes

Primary

MeasureTime frameDescription
Pain levelParticipant will record the level of pain felt immediately after receiving the injection. This usually occurs around 10 mins after the start of the appointment.Measured subjectively using an Arabic validated Wong-Baker Faces Pain Rating Scale by the participant choosing the picture that best describes the pain they felt. Minimum score is zero, maximum score is 10. Score of zero is the best outcome, which translates into No hurt = no pain felt. Score of 10 is the worst outcome, which translates into Hurts most = severe pain felt

Secondary

MeasureTime frameDescription
Behavior and cooperationThis metric is measured by judging the participant's behavior, and is recorded after the injection is given. This will take around 10 mins from the start of the appointment.Measured using Frankl behavior scale. The investigator monitoring the participant will record the participant's behavior during and after receiving the injection. Behavior can be scored as definitely negative (--), negative (-), positive (+), or definitely positive (++). A score of (--) is the worst outcome, and a score of (++) is the best outcome.
